The Large Skipper is a butterfly of the Hesperiidae family, which occurs throughout Europe. It was long known as ''Ochlodes venata'', but this is a Far Eastern relative. There is still some dispute whether this species should be considered a distinct species or included in ''O. venata'' as a subspecies.
